It is probably an issue with your network. Do you have the same problem if you connect your pc directly to the radio? A loss of the panadapter is because of dropped packets. Look at the network strength indicator in the lower right side of SmartSDR. If its not showing green bars, then that is a good indication of a problem with your network.

Update your video driver.
There was an issue with Intel IRIS video driver causing freezing panadapter/waterfall. You can search the Community for Intel Video driver.

I ran into a problem yesterday when I updated my Drivers on my NUC-I8 with the Intel IRIS Graphic 655 graphic chip and every time I brought up the Memory window (which I use a lot) it locked up SmartSDR.
I had to go back to the original 2018 Drivers for things to start working again so just make sure you check all features after you update the Video drivers and be sure you have a backup before you try it.

As a follow up, I wanted to report to the group that I resolved my issue, sort of.
As many pointed out here, the issue is with the Intel graphics drivers. Even after I downloaded and installed the latest drivers my issue was not resolved. It was only after I disable the "hardware acceleration" and I was able to get everything to work, this is why I said "sort of". I would assume that eventually the drivers will be fixed but for now the Nuc is not running its graphics at full potential. That being said, frankly, I see no difference in waterfall / panadapter speed or responsiveness.
I hope this helps someone who may run into the same issue. Tim E at Flex was great and helped tremendously.
